Know You Mushrooms! is a funny, quirky, and very educational film about one of the world’s most numerous organisms; mushrooms. In this documentary, we meet Larry Evans, a mycologist (mushroom expert) who takes us to both the Telluride Mushroom Festival, and around the world, on a mushroom hunting expedition. The travels with Larry Evans are interspliced with old film clips, old ads and PSAs about mushrooms, as well as fun, animated factoids entitled “Fun with Fungi”.


We are introduced to many different mushrooms, from crude oil eating oyster mushrooms, to hallucinogenic psylocibes, from mushrooms that are good to eat; to ones that are toxic. Mainly this film focuses on the many edible species. I never realised that so many edible ones existed. Seeing them all just made me hungry.


We also hear about mushrooms in literature, such as the fly agaric in Alice in Wonderland. After watching this film, I gained a new appreciation for these seemingly humble fungi.

Know Your Mushrooms is the latest documentary from Canadian Ron Mann. Like his previous films, it provides a remarkable amount of information without taking itself too seriously. The film follows two world class fungus evangelists, Gary Lincoff and Larry Evans, as they hold forth at the Telluride CO Mushroom Festival. Fitting the stereotype of aging hippies, they tell stories, take groups into the woods to gather mushrooms, and even cook them up for their guests. Various types of fungus are covered, including medicinal, psychedelic and one that digests oil spills. Each type is introduced by an animated clip with a multiple choice question. Some interesting archival footage is also provided, for example of gringos under the stonefaced supervision of a shaman laughing hysterically on their first psychedelic trip. The light tone is supported by music from the Flaming Lips.


Remarkably, this was my first Ron Mann documentary. At 73 minutes it was just the right length–always informative and entertaining and never boring.
